Field service operations have undergone a dramatic transformation in the last decade, thanks to digital advancements. Gone are the days when technicians juggled paper-based schedules and handwritten reports. Today, businesses are turning to software for field service and adopting comprehensive field service software solutions to enhance productivity, improve customer satisfaction, and streamline operations.
Whether you’re managing a plumbing company, HVAC service, electrical team, or IT support business, adopting the right digital management tools can drive massive gains in efficiency and profitability. But how do you choose the right solution in a crowded market?
This blog will guide you through everything you need to know about these platforms, what they are, why you need them, the features to look for, and a look into the future.
Listen To The Podcast Now!
What Is Field Service Software?
A digital solution designed to manage and optimize operations conducted outside of the office, typically at a client’s location, field service software helps businesses schedule jobs, dispatch workers, track time, manage inventory, and streamline invoicing.
Its core benefit lies in the ability to centralize operations into a single platform. This enables managers and technicians to stay connected in real-time, improving communication, coordination, and accountability.
Widely used in industries such as maintenance, repair, installation, and inspection services, this technology eliminates manual processes and delivers improved operational visibility.
Ultimately, implementing a modern field service management software solution customized for on-site operations can lead to substantial improvements in both efficiency and customer satisfaction. Whether you manage a small local repair business or a large-scale maintenance operation, equipping your team with the right technology ensures better coordination, quicker response times, and a more seamless, professional service experience.
Why Businesses Need Field Service Software?
Managing a service business isn’t just about fixing things or completing tasks; it’s about being on time, staying organized, and keeping both your team and customers happy. As expectations rise and operations become more complex, relying on old-school methods like whiteboards, paper forms, or scattered apps can seriously slow you down. That’s why more businesses are turning to smart tools that simplify how everything runs behind the scenes.
Here are the reasons why businesses need field service software:
Improved Scheduling & Dispatching:
Coordinating schedules manually can lead to double bookings, delays, or sending the wrong technician to a job. Smart scheduling tools take the guesswork out by automatically assigning the right person based on skills, location, and availability. This leads to quicker response times and more efficient use of resources. You can also adjust schedules on the fly as priorities shift, with less back-and-forth.
Real-Time Communication:
Miscommunication between the field and the office can slow down jobs and create confusion. With mobile access and instant updates, your team stays in sync at all times. Technicians can get job details, updates, or notes right on their phone, while the office can track progress and provide support when needed. Everyone works with the same information in real time.
Enhanced Customer Satisfaction:
Today’s customers expect timely updates, clear communication, and professional service. With field service software, you can provide accurate appointment windows, send reminders, and follow up automatically after a job is done. Clients appreciate being kept in the loop and knowing when to expect service. These small touches go a long way toward building loyalty and trust.
Performance Monitoring:
Keeping track of how your team performs is crucial for growth. With built-in reporting and analytics, you can monitor job durations, technician productivity, customer feedback, and more. This helps you recognize top performers and identify areas for improvement. Over time, it supports better training, clearer goals, and stronger results for your whole operation.
To further enhance team performance and accountability, businesses can integrate workforce productivity tools like EmpMonitor. This tool provides deep insights into employee activities, time usage, and engagement metrics, making it a perfect complement to field service software for managing both in-office and on-field teams.
Faster Invoicing & Payments:
Waiting days to generate invoices can slow down your cash flow and frustrate customers. Automated tools let you send bills immediately after a job is completed, often from the technician’s device in the field. You can also offer digital payment options, making it easier for clients to pay on the spot. This speeds up revenue collection and reduces paperwork.
Simply put, using the right digital tools helps you run your business more smoothly, respond faster, and create better experiences for both your team and your customers.
Also Read:
Time Tracking Software For Employees: The Next Big Thing In Productivity Tools
Key Features To Look For In Field Service Software
Not every solution is built the same, so it’s important to know what features will truly benefit your business.
Here are the core capabilities to look for when choosing the right tool:
-
Mobile Accessibility:
Technicians should be able to view schedules, update work orders, and capture job details directly from their smartphones. This keeps them productive in the field. It also reduces the need for callbacks to the office.
-
Real-Time GPS Tracking:
Know exactly where your team is in real time to improve dispatching and accountability. It also helps reassure customers with accurate ETAs. Plus, it enhances safety by monitoring routes and time on-site.
-
Automated Scheduling:
Say goodbye to manual planning. Automated systems assign the right technician based on skill and availability. It also makes rescheduling a breeze with drag-and-drop calendars or AI-powered suggestions.
-
Inventory Management:
Track equipment, parts, and supplies from anywhere. This ensures technicians always have what they need to complete a job. It also reduces delays caused by missing or misplaced items.
-
Job History Tracking:
Maintain detailed records of past services for each customer. This helps technicians arrive prepared and allows managers to analyze recurring issues. It also improves communication and long-term service planning.
-
Integrated Invoicing:
Generate invoices automatically when a job is done and allow customers to pay instantly. This speeds up your payment cycle. It also cuts down on paperwork and reduces billing errors.
Choosing a solution with these features gives your business the tools it needs to operate smarter and stay competitive in a fast-moving industry.
Also Read:
09 Reasons Why You Need To Improve Communication Skills
9 Benefits of Employee Location Tracking for Business Efficiency
Field Service Software Vs Traditional Methods
Traditional service management often relies on manual tools like spreadsheets, phone calls, and paperwork. Scheduling is handled through Excel or written logs, which makes it difficult to avoid conflicts and track updates in real time.
Communication between field teams and office staff usually happens via phone or email. This can cause delays, missed messages, and confusion, especially when handling urgent requests or last-minute changes.
Documentation is another challenge. Paper records are easy to lose and hard to organize, while GPS tracking is typically non-existent, leaving managers in the dark about technician locations and job status.
By switching to modern digital solutions, businesses gain real-time scheduling, in-app messaging, digital documentation, live GPS tracking, and automated invoicing. These features drastically reduce errors, cut costs, and significantly improve team productivity.
How To Choose The Right Field Service Software?
Selecting the right software for field service can seem overwhelming. Here are some tips to help you make a well-informed decision:
Define Your Needs:
Start by clearly identifying the specific challenges your business faces. Do you need help primarily with scheduling and dispatching, or are inventory management and invoicing equally important? Understanding your priorities ensures you pick software with the right features that address your day-to-day operations.
Look for Scalability:
Choose a platform that can grow with your business. As your team expands or your service offerings diversify, the software should be able to handle increased workloads, additional users, and new functionalities without requiring a complete overhaul or expensive upgrades.
Check Integration Capabilities:
Your new tool should work seamlessly with the other software you already use, such as accounting systems, customer relationship management (CRM) platforms, or time-tracking apps. Strong integration reduces duplicate data entry, streamlines workflows, and helps maintain accurate records across departments.
Consider User Experience:
An intuitive and user-friendly interface is crucial for successful adoption by your team. If the software is complicated or cumbersome, technicians and managers may resist using it consistently, limiting the benefits. Look for platforms with simple navigation, mobile access, and helpful support resources.
Read Reviews & Request Demos:
Before committing, research user feedback to learn about real-world experiences with the software. Pay attention to common praise or complaints. Also, request a demo or trial period to test the software hands-on, ensuring it meets your expectations and fits your workflow.
As part of this process, consider whether the platform functions effectively as a field management system, a centralized solution that supports both office coordination and on-site service execution.
What Is A Field Service Program?
A field service program refers to a structured approach designed to manage and optimize all activities that take place outside the traditional office environment. This program typically includes organizing work orders, assigning tasks, scheduling technicians, and monitoring performance to ensure jobs are completed efficiently and on time. It acts as a blueprint for how field operations are conducted within a business.
While many people use the term interchangeably with technology solutions, a field service program is broader. It not only involves the tools and software used but also the company’s internal processes, such as training staff, setting service standards, and defining performance metrics. These elements work together to create a consistent and effective way of managing fieldwork.
The success of a field service program depends largely on how well these procedures align with the technology supporting them. When combined with reliable field service software, the program gains powerful capabilities like real-time tracking, automated scheduling, and data-driven insights that enhance decision-making and accountability.
When supported by the right technology, a comprehensive field service program enables businesses to streamline workflows, reduce errors, and respond more quickly to customer needs. This combination fosters greater team productivity and ensures services are delivered consistently and professionally, helping companies stay competitive in a demanding market.
Real-World Applications Of Field Service Software Program
Real-world use cases of field service software are diverse and impactful:
- HVAC Services: Schedule repairs and installations while keeping customers informed.
- Telecommunications: Track equipment, assign technicians, and manage maintenance.
- Utilities: Automate meter readings, maintenance, and service checks.
- Medical Equipment Servicing: Maintain records and schedule routine inspections.
- IT Support Teams: Manage troubleshooting, installations, and updates across client locations.
In each scenario, modern software streamlines processes, improves visibility, and enhances customer satisfaction.
How To Boost Field Force Productivity With EmpMonitor
While field service software streamlines scheduling, dispatching, and job tracking, EmpMonitor adds a critical layer of visibility into how your team operates throughout the day, especially when they’re on the move. Tailored to support distributed, mobile, and remote teams, EmpMonitor provides actionable insights that help boost both field force productivity and accountability.
Here are five field service-specific features of EmpMonitor that align perfectly with service operations:
1. Live Location Tracking:
Location tracking allows you to monitor the real-time whereabouts of your field technicians, ensuring they follow the correct routes and arrive at client sites on time. This enhances dispatch decisions and promotes transparency across teams.
2. Geo-Verified Client Visits:
EmpMonitor validates whether your field agents visited the designated client location, helping to maintain service integrity and reduce fraudulent check-ins.
3. Advanced Geofencing:
Set up virtual boundaries around specific job sites. Receive automatic alerts when a technician enters or exits a geofenced area, ensuring timely arrivals and monitoring job duration more effectively.
4. Performance Reports:
Get a complete overview of each technician’s productivity with detailed performance reports. Analyze job timelines, on-site duration, and service outcomes to identify top performers or areas that need support.
5. Centralized Dashboard:
Access all field operations from a single dashboard. Whether it’s monitoring activity, managing schedules, or analyzing visits, this central hub simplifies decision-making and coordination.
EmpMonitor makes managing your field team smarter, faster, and more reliably.
Future Trends In Field Service Software
The future of field service software is shaped by innovation. These are emerging trends worth watching closely:
- AI & Machine Learning: Predict maintenance needs and optimize scheduling.
- Augmented Reality: Offer remote visual assistance to field workers.
- IoT Integration: Real-time data from connected devices to trigger service requests.
- Voice-Activated Commands: Improve hands-free task management.
- Predictive Analytics: Use historical data to forecast trends and improve decision-making.
As technology evolves, field service software will only become more intelligent and indispensable.
Conclusion
Unlocking the power of field service software is not just about adopting a new tool; it’s about transforming how your business operates. From automated scheduling and real-time tracking to invoicing and customer satisfaction, the benefits are tangible and immediate.
When paired with EmpMonitor, you get a full-circle solution that ensures your workforce is not only efficient but also accountable and engaged.
Now is the time to invest in field service software. It’s not a luxury, it’s a necessity for scaling operations, improving customer experience, and staying competitive in a digital-first world.
Take the first step today and choose a solution that aligns with your goals, scales with your business, and integrates seamlessly with productivity tools like EmpMonitor.
FAQs
1: Can field service software work without an internet connection?
Ans. Yes, many field service software platforms offer offline functionality. Technicians can access job details, fill out forms, and update work orders without an internet connection. Once connectivity is restored, the data syncs automatically with the central system. This is especially valuable for field teams working in remote areas or places with unstable networks.
2: Can field service software integrate with accounting tools?
Ans. Yes, most platforms integrate with tools like QuickBooks, Xero, or Zoho Books.
This enables seamless invoicing, payroll syncing, and financial reporting.
Integration reduces manual entry and boosts accuracy.
3: What kind of training is required to use field service software effectively?
Ans. Most field service software is user-friendly, but basic training boosts adoption and efficiency. Onboarding sessions, tutorials, and support ensure quicker proficiency and fewer errors.